The Background Check That Took Eleven Days

I applied for a job stocking shelves overnight, the kind of position I would have been too proud to mention a decade ago. By the time I walked out of that interview I did not care about pride anymore. I just wanted someone to say yes. The manager told me it would take a few business days for the background check to clear, given what was on my record, then shook my hand and said he would be in touch. Eleven days. I counted every one. I checked my phone so often my wife started asking if I was expecting news from the hospital. Impatience does not feel like a small thing when you are living inside it. It feels like the only sane response to a world that will not move at the speed you need it to move. I told myself I was just being responsible, staying on top of things, but underneath that story was a simpler truth. I did not trust that the waiting itself might be doing something. The Prayer List I Almost Threw Away

# The Prayer List I Almost Threw Away I keep a prayer list in the back of my Bible, folded so many times the creases have gone soft as cloth. One name has been on it for six years, the kind of prayer I pray every single day and watch come back unanswered in the exact same shape it left. A few months ago I sat in my truck in a church parking lot, list in my hand, and thought about just leaving it there on the seat. Not tearing it up. Just walking away from it, the way you walk away from a conversation you have decided is not going anywhere. That is doubt in its most honest form, not the dramatic kind where a man shakes his fist at the sky, but the quiet kind where you simply stop expecting an answer and call it being realistic. I used to think doubt disqualified a person from real faith, that the men and women in the Bible who trusted God must have done it without ever wondering if He was listening.
